WebHow far a Bluetooth signal reaches depends on the transmission class. Classes 2 and 3 achieve ranges of 5 to 30 metres. This standard is built into most devices – such as Bluetooth headphones, speakers, wearables or even most smartphones. With class 1, ranges of 100 meters or even more are possible. Web18 okt. 2016 · Your chances of using ANY protocol at 2.4GHz (not just BlueTooth) are essentially zero. That is also why submarines use sonar and not radar underwater. Extremely low frequencies (10KHz and lower) are used to communicate to submarines when submerged. It is also the reason cops don't use radar when it is raining.

Web2 okt. 2024 · While there are plenty of differences, the following stand out as the most impactful advantages of Bluetooth 5.0: Higher bandwidth: While Bluetooth 4.2 transmits data at 1 Mbps, Bluetooth 5.0 doubles that to 2 Mbps. Longer range: Bluetooth 4.2 can hold connection to another device for a maximum of 60 meters (200 feet).
